RDVA, Inc. designs and manufactures foam packaging and products in the United States. The company offers various custom protective packaging products; packaging products, including corner pads, edge pads, and specialty items; standard and specialty insulated containers; and specialty components and shapes. Its products are used in various industries, which include high technology, agriculture, telecommunications, consumer electronics, automotive, appliances, building products, military, textile, furniture, pharmaceuticals, agriculture, medical, perishable foods, wine and beer, food and beverage, and manufacturing industries. RDVA, Inc. was founded in 1962 and is based in Radford, Virginia.
